Self Portrait Study
Self Portrait Study
“Self Portrait Study” offers a glimpse into a moment of introspective quiet. Rendered with swift, visible brushwork, the portrait eschews precise detail for a focus on emotional resonance. A cool palette of blues and violets is warmed by subtle rose tones in the skin, creating a compelling interplay of light and shadow across the face. The artist’s handling of paint is immediate and direct, lending a sense of vulnerability to the subject’s gaze. There is a palpable tension between the defined structure of the face and the looser, more fluid treatment of the surrounding space. This study is not a presentation of self, but an exploration of interiority—a fleeting impression captured with both honesty and restraint.
